Mathuradanga is an inhabited village in Barjora Block of Bankura district, West Bengal. Its Census village code is 327353, the Census 2011 record lists 430 people in 103 households and the reported area is 77.88 hectares. The local references include Barjora CD Block and the nearest town reference is Sonamukhi at about 14 km.

Population and Social Groups
The Census 2011 record lists 430 people in 103 households, with 218 male residents and 212 female residents. The average household size is 4.17, and SC share is 95.35% and ST share is 0% for Mathuradanga. Population density works out to about 552.13 people per sq km.

Power Supply
Domestic power supply for Mathuradanga is reported as 18 hours per day in summer and 20 hours per day in winter. Treat this as historical Census/District Census Handbook data.

Land Use and Local Economy
Land-use records for Mathuradanga show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y and Wheat, net sown area is 56.67 hectares and irrigated land is 32.78 hectares (57.8%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
